With 210.0 calories per serving (1 Serving (40.0g)), Paleo Dark Chocolate Cashew Almond is a moderately calorie-dense food worth tracking if you're managing your intake. The majority of its calories come from fat (14.0g, 58.9% of calories), including 3.0g of saturated fat.
📝 Ingredients
Cashews, Sunflower Seeds, Organic Tapioca Syrup, Almonds, Cocoa Coating (sugar, Palm Kernel Oil*, Cocoa Powder, Sunflower Lecithin, Salt), Organic Agave Syrup, Pumpkin Seeds, Sesame Seeds, Chia Seeds, Sea Salt.
